A land drain can be a watercourse as outlined inside the Land Drainage Act 1991. Normally, the main obligation for the maintenance of the watercourse rests Together with the landowner and, for that reason, a landowner has the primary responsibility for safeguarding their land and close by residence from flooding because of a blocked watercourse.

A land drain is often known as a French drain. It is made up of perforated plastic drain pipes that happen to be laid into trenches dug in the bottom. Smaller stones are piled more than the pipe and during the trench.

By Liz Tomas Drainage is used to hold excess h2o off agricultural land and also to deposit it elsewhere. Places that don't have ample drainage could become waterlogged, which inhibits plant advancement.

A further use for land drainage within the backyard is as a collector drain, mounted as one line, 300-450mm from the edge of the pavement to more info carry away the area operate-off and stop the backyard garden from turning out to be water-logged.
